  • Genesis-Plus-GX

    An enhanced port of Genesis Plus - accurate & portable Sega 8/16 bit emulator

    The Titan Overdrive 2 demo runs in BlastEm, but not in GPGX. And BlastEm is still the only software emulator to show CRAM dots.
